Bilhah grew up in the Goddess House, training to be a concubine. Prince January doesn't want a slave girl, but the King is determined he must have one. Can they find happiness despite the brutal expectations of their world? Fantasy romance, inspired by reading/watching too much Dune, Game of Thrones, the Witcher and the Handmaid's Tale.
